About Letterkenny Airfield

Letterkenny Airfield (EILT) is a general aviation airport and airfield located in Letterkenny, IE. The facility operates at an elevation of 20 feet above sea level and primarily serves private aircraft, flight training, and general aviation activities.

The facility features 1 runway (08/26) with GRASS/HARDCORE surface . Weather services provide regular METAR reports and TAF forecasts to ensure safe flight operations in all conditions.
